Organization: Endo 3rd Job Summary: Ensures the accurate assembly of instrument trays and/or equipment independently. Utilization of the instrument tracking system and maintaining adequate sterilization of instrumentation and/or equipment by preparation of requested instrumentation and/or equipment for surgical and clinical procedures. Assists with ensuring staff are following guidelines and assignments of tasks are completed timely and accurately. Shift Details: 10:30PM - 7:00AM Monday-Friday . Shift: Monday-Friday Hours: 11:00pm-7:00am Key Responsibilities: Assists with orientation and every day workflow of assignments of new employees. Assist with development of in-service for staff members. Coordinates daily workflow with staff members to ensure timely completion. Monitors workflow performed by staff to ensure correctness. Demonstrates and understands principles of sterilization in preparing items for OR and clinic use. Operates all sterilization and HLD equipment according to manufacture requirements and departmental policies. Demonstrates and understands principles of decontamination and standard precautions. Assures that all employees demonstrate and understand the principles of decontamination. Understands and has the ability to function as a sterile processing technician and/or endoscopy tech specialist. Monitors and inventories the supplies and ensures instrumentation is available for OR and clinical areas. Ensures implementation of standards within the quality assurance monitoring process and improvements are followed. Monitors record keeping of repairs, maintenance, quality assurance measures are up to date and documented daily. Maintains and reviews missing instrumentation. Puts in requests for missing instrument orders and instrument par needed to maintain functioning instrument trays. We’re the largest private employer in Middle Tennessee, with a growing team and an expanding footprint across towns and communities throughout the region. We employ more than 43,000 people who work in inpatient and outpatient clinical care, research and graduate medical education. Our employees also serve in critical supporting roles in administration, information technology and informatics, finance, legal and community affairs, communications and marketing, fundraising, groundskeeping and facilities, and many other departments. Our growing academic health system has more than 2,100 licensed hospital beds at eight hospitals: Vanderbilt University Hospital Monroe Carell Jr. Children’s Hospital at Vanderbilt Vanderbilt Psychiatric Hospital Vanderbilt Stallworth Rehabilitation Hospital Vanderbilt Bedford Hospital Vanderbilt Clarksville Hospital Vanderbilt Tullahoma-Harton Hospital Vanderbilt Wilson County Hospital Vanderbilt Health is the Mid-South's largest provider of specialty care, with hundreds of outpatient clinic and surgical locations throughout the region, and Tennessee’s only National Cancer Institute-designated Comprehensive Cancer Center for adults and children. We are one of the nation's busiest critical care centers, home to Middle Tennessee’s only Level 1 Trauma Center and Burn Center for adults and children, and Middle Tennessee’s only Level IV Neonatal Intensive Care Unit. We are the nation’s largest transplant center, and last year we performed the most heart transplants than any center worldwide. Vanderbilt Health is an epicenter for biomedical research, winning over $1 billion in annual research awards from government, industry, foundations and donors. We are also a national leader in medical training and education, with the largest clinical training center in the Mid-South and the only training center in Tennessee for many adult and pediatric specialties. We’re honored to be consistently considered among the nation’s best hospitals for quality, safety and patient satisfaction. Three of our hospitals — Vanderbilt University Hospital, Vanderbilt Psychiatric Hospital and Vanderbilt Wilson County Hospital — have been awarded a Five-Star Quality Rating from Medicare.
